Noun

Etymology: Varro claims the term derives from Ancient Greek δεπέσταν (depéstan), although this term is unattested outside of Varro. It is more likely that it derives from the similar form λεπαστή (lepastḗ). It is possible that the term proposed by Varro is connected to δέπαστρον (dépastron), from δέπας (dépas). Varro also implies that the term may have been borrowed from Sabine, although he may also suggest that the Latin and Sabine term both derive from the same source.
